Establishing the correct diagnosis

It is essential to make the right diagnosis of the fears of future participants. The purpose of this course is to help you overcome your fear of flying, and that is exactly what it does. But in one out of four candidates their fear of flying is the result of other underlying causes that have to be dealt with first.

It has little or no use to have a person with agoraphobia who doesn’t dare to take a train or enter a supermarket follow a training to overcome their fear of flying. For agoraphobia or “other” underlying reasons for fear of flying there are dedicated, often very efficient treatment methods that can later on be followed by a fear of flying course.
